Council Rates Rip Off?

I was having a whinge on Fa*****k about the extortionate council rates I was paying of nearly $300 (£150) a quarter which worked out at over $3 (£1.50) a day. It seems a lot to borrow a library book, go to a swimming pool, have someone collect your garbage and maintain the local roads.

My brother who lives in Macclesfield (someone has to ) chimed in saying he would pay my rates if I paid his. He said his rates worked out at £5.85 ($12) a day.

Is this true? are UK rates really that high?

We are always being told that economies of scale lead to cheaper rates and I suspect the UK councils have much bigger populations than here and perhaps some council business is carried on by the state government here (funded by GST revenue) but even so paying four times the rates seems unbelievable to me.

That is an interesting comparison Julie. I had to look up the minimum wage to see what it is here - currently it is $16.37 (a bit over £8 p/h) for full time work or $20.30 (£10) for casual workers. It is amended every six months I believe. It would therefore take 12 minutes work for someone on minimum wage to pay my rates.

Very few workers get the minimum wage because most jobs have an award which defines rates and conditions but unfortunately some do (mostly cleaners and casual labourers) .

Having read what people have written here I shall stop complaining about my rates (well, not for a while anyway ) though I have to say I don't understand why UK rates are so high.
